Tesla announced the expansion of its Robotaxi service to Orlando and Tampa on Wednesday, widening the geographic footprint of its autonomous ride-hailing network just hours before Chief Executive Elon Musk is expected to update investors on the company’s self-driving plan during its second-quarter earnings call.
The electric vehicle maker disclosed the expansion in a post on X, publishing maps showing the operational service areas in both Florida cities. Tesla did not reveal how many vehicles would initially operate in either market, when riders would be able to begin requesting trips, or whether the service would launch with supervised or fully driverless vehicles.
The timing of the announcement is notable, coming immediately before what is likely to be one of the most closely watched earnings calls in Tesla’s recent history. With electric vehicle sales facing increasing competitive pressure and margins under strain, investors have focused more on Robotaxi as the company’s primary long-term growth driver. Demonstrating geographic expansion allows Tesla to reinforce its narrative that commercial deployment of autonomous transportation is accelerating.

The announcement also follows months of heightened scrutiny over whether Tesla’s Robotaxi rollout is keeping pace with Musk’s ambitious projections.
Tesla’s current Robotaxi deployment remains substantially smaller than the vision Musk outlined last year.
In 2024, Musk said Robotaxi would be available to roughly half of the U.S. population by the end of 2025. He later predicted that Tesla would operate more than 500 autonomous vehicles in the Austin area alone before the end of the year.
Available data suggest the rollout remains far below those expectations.
Independent tracking data indicate Tesla’s Robotaxi fleet has fluctuated considerably over recent months. In May, trackers estimated the company had approximately 29 unsupervised Robotaxis in Austin, alongside six in Houston and five in Dallas. Current estimates suggest those numbers have since declined to around 17 unsupervised vehicles in Austin, four in Dallas, and none in Houston, highlighting the inconsistency of Tesla’s deployment strategy.
Unlike conventional fleet expansions, Tesla has not explained why the number of active Robotaxis has periodically increased and then contracted across different markets.
Tesla Trails Waymo in Commercial Deployment
The rollout also reveals the widening gap between Tesla and Alphabet-owned Waymo, which remains the clear leader in commercial autonomous ride-hailing. Waymo is estimated to operate more than 3,500 fully driverless vehicles across more than 10 U.S. metropolitan areas, providing hundreds of thousands of paid trips each week.
Tesla, by comparison, continues to expand cautiously while experimenting with different operating models.
Like Waymo, Tesla typically begins operations in new cities with a safety driver behind the wheel. In some cases, however, Tesla later moved the safety operator into the front passenger seat, where they retain access to an emergency stop or “kill switch” should intervention become necessary. The company has not established a consistent framework for transitioning between supervised and unsupervised operations, making it difficult for investors to assess the maturity of its autonomous driving system.
The expansion into Florida comes as Tesla continues to face operational questions about the readiness of its Robotaxi platform. Users and observers have reported that limited fleet sizes have resulted in lengthy passenger wait times in existing markets.
There have also been reports of vehicles arriving at incorrect pickup or drop-off locations, while some supposedly unsupervised Robotaxis have relied on remote human operators to assist with difficult driving situations.
Earlier this month, an unsupervised Tesla Robotaxi reportedly collided with a tree stump while being remotely operated, raising fresh questions about the system’s ability to safely handle edge-case scenarios without human intervention.
The incident adds to ongoing regulatory and public scrutiny surrounding Tesla’s Full Self-Driving technology, which differs fundamentally from Waymo’s approach. Tesla relies primarily on cameras and artificial intelligence, while Waymo combines cameras with lidar, radar, and high-definition mapping to create multiple layers of environmental sensing.
Robotaxi Central to Tesla’s Valuation
Despite the limited scale of the rollout, Robotaxi has become important to Tesla’s investment case. With growth in electric vehicle deliveries slowing and competition intensifying globally, many analysts believe Tesla’s premium valuation increasingly depends on its ability to commercialize autonomous transportation and AI-powered mobility services.
Musk has repeatedly said that autonomous ride-hailing could transform Tesla from an automobile manufacturer into an artificial intelligence and robotics company, generating substantially higher margins through software-driven transportation services. He has projected that Robotaxi operations will become profitable by 2027, although analysts remain divided over whether Tesla can achieve fully autonomous operation at commercial scale within that timeframe.
Wednesday’s expansion into Orlando and Tampa provides Tesla with another milestone to showcase ahead of earnings. However, investors are expected to focus less on the number of cities served and more on metrics such as fleet size, utilization rates, safety performance, regulatory approvals and the pace at which Tesla can transition from small pilot programs to a commercially viable autonomous ride-hailing network.
Those details are likely to feature prominently when Musk discusses Robotaxi during Tesla’s earnings conference call later in the day.
